[ ] Key ceremony step 4 — Pinewell Clinic reminder job. Once both custodians confirm the signing shard is sealed, re-enable the nightly appointment reminder sender and watch the first batch go out. If the scheduler account got locked during the ceremony (it happens), unlock it with the recovery passphrase below.

unlock words, hahip-baduf: holwyn-istath-julvan

Onboarding: Kiosk Watchdog (for plugin authors)

The Ferrowell kiosk runtime runs a watchdog that restarts any plugin unresponsive for 20 seconds. Your plugin must answer heartbeat pings on the provided channel; avoid blocking the main loop. Three consecutive restarts trigger safe mode. Exiting safe mode on a locked kiosk requires the recovery passphrase below.

vault phrase of tajeg-tageg = pelix-druix-holius-briael-zorwyn-frawyn-fraox-norok-drueth-aldiel

## Step 2: Rebuild on the slim base

Switch the Cartonworks build to the new distroless base image. The multi-stage Dockerfile drops build tools from the final layer, cutting image size from 1.2 GB to around 180 MB. Rebuild, run the smoke tests, and push to the internal registry. The runtime reads its settings at boot, reproduced here.

deployment values, yadug-bawif:
[framir]
team = pelox
access_code = ac_a38ab2
owner = tamion.julael
host = framir.tolvaqlabs.test
port = 11211
peer = tammir.zemvargrid.local
salt = 2215ef03
pin = 1541

## Incremental Rebuilds — Env Vars

Staticforge rebuilds only pages whose content hash changed. Required vars: REBUILD_CONCURRENCY (default 4), CACHE_DIR, and WEBHOOK_SOURCE set to "pressroom". Do not raise concurrency above 8; the hash store locks per shard. Full rebuilds: set FORCE_FULL=1 once, then unset. The rebuild trigger authenticates against the Pressroom CMS, so your env file must include the shared trigger secret on the next line.

vault entry, yahif-yajep: COURIER_KEY29=b802bdf8034096b65a51c6ba5abe2